Yvon Le Roux (born 19 April 1960) is a French former professional footballer who played as a defender. He earned 28 international caps (one goal) for the France national team during the mid-1980s and was part of the team at the 1986 FIFA World Cup and the team that won UEFA Euro 1984. Whilst at Marseille he helped them to the league and cup double in 1989.
